    Here are the 16 shortlisted engineers shortlisted for the 2018 Africa Prize for Engineering Innovation

    1
    By Staff Writer on November 23, 2017 Africa

    Sixteen engineers have been shortlisted for the 2018 Africa Prize for Engineering Innovation. The announcement was made in Cape Town, South Africa recently. The shortlist includes engineers working to make malaria and reproductive health tests easier, using dolphin-inspired echo-location for visually impaired people, and recovering precious metals from car parts for re-use in manufacturing. The group also includes agricultural innovators and process engineers, as well entrepreneurs developing educational solutions and digital apps.

    The engineers are now embarking upon a six-month programme of support including funding, business training, bespoke mentoring and access to the Royal Academy of Engineering’s network of engineers and business development experts. In June 2018, finalists will present their businesses to judges in front of a live audience before a winner and three runners-up are chosen.

    The shortlisted engineers are listed below:

    • Shalton Mphodisa of AEON Power Bag, South Africa
    • Collins Tatenda Saguru of AltMet, South Africa
    • Nnaemeka Chidiebere Ikegwuonu and team, of ColdHubs, Nigeria
    • Esther Gacicio, of eLearning Solutions, Kenya
    • Daniel Taylor of HWESOMAME, Ghana
    • Ifediora Emmanuel Ugochukwu of iMeter, Nigeria
    • Arthur Wonaila of Khainza Energy Gas, Uganda
    • Emeka Obewe of Kitozu, Nigeria
    • Monicah Mumbi Wambugu of Loanbee, kenya
    • Brian Gitta and team of Matibabu, Uganda
    • Nges Njungle of Muzikol, Cameroon
    • Peter Kariuki and team of SafeMotos, Rwanda
    • Michael Asante-Afrifa of Science Set, Ghana
    • Brian Mwiti Mwenda of The Sixth Sense, Kenya
    • Okettayot Lawrence of Sparky Dryer, Uganda
    • Alvin Leonard  Kabwama of UriSAF, Uganda
